草庐IT

forM1Mac

全部标签

php - Laravel:如何将参数传递到我的 View 并在 Form::text 和 Form::date 中显示它们?

我正在尝试制作用于编辑字段的View。其实我有两个问题:1)我使用我的Controller从我的数据库中获取我的数据,这是有效的,我尝试将它传递给我的View,但那是行不通的...2)我想在Form::text和Form::date中显示这些数据,这不起作用...我的Controller中有什么:publicfunctionedit($id){$data=DB::connection('my-db')->table('my-table')->where('id','=',$id)->select('field1','field2')->first();returnview('my-vi

php - 在 Zend MVC 中使用 Zend_Form 的更好方法

当使用Zend_Form时,我发现自己创建了很多看起来像这样的Controller方法:functioneditPersonAction(){$model=$this->getPersonModel();$form=$this->getPersonEditForm();if($this->getRequest()->isPost(){$data=$this->getRequest()->getPost();//$form->populate($data);[removedinedit]if($form->isValid($data)){$data=$form->getValues();

php - 添加验证 GreaterThan - Zend Form

setMethod('post');$this->setLegend('AudienceDetails');$this->addElement('text','audience_total',array('label'=>'AudienceTotal:','required'=>true,'filters'=>array('Digits'),'size'=>15,'validators'=>array('Digits',)));....remainingcode.....请帮助修改以上代码以应用GreaterThan验证。谢谢 最佳答案

php - 有没有办法在使用 coda 的 Mac 商店中使用 SVN 进行 Web 开发?

因此,我们正在插入在我们的办公室中创建良好的流程。我在一家从事网站build已有十多年的网店工作。而且我们不使用版本控制。我知道!这很糟糕,不是我的错。我是至少有SoftE背景的人插入这一点。技术负责人一直在调查它。我们都使用Mac工作站并且主要使用Coda进行编辑,因为它是一个很棒的IDE。它内置了SVN支持,但希望它能处理本地文件。我们正在尝试探索使用SFTP工具将Web目录安装为本地网络驱动器。顺便说一下,我们是一家LAMP商店。我想知道这里的模型是什么。我认为我们通常会将整个站点checkout到我们运行apache的本地机器上,然后在那里进行测试?这不是我们的工作方式,我们在

php - 蛋糕PHP : how to get an array of elements from a web form

在我的cakephp表单中,我有以下代码input('option[]',array('size'=>13));?>input('option[]',array('size'=>13));?>input('option[]',array('size'=>13));?>input('option[]',array('size'=>13));?>我正在尝试从一组输入文本框中获取值,文本框的数量可以由用户设置,因此无法为每个文本框提供单独的名称,但是如何从我的Controller中获取要插入的值数据到数据库表谢谢 最佳答案 您可以保留表格

php - 在 Mac OS X Lion (10.7) 上重写 Apache2 中的相对路径

我已经彻底搜索了该网站并用Google搜索了这个,但无济于事。我在我的MacOSX上使用Apache2+PHP。我没有改变其中任何一个的太多配置,足以让一切正常工作。这是我的.htaccess文件:Options+FollowSymLinksOptions+IndexesRewriteBase/~milad/mysite/RewriteEngineOnRewriteRule^$index.php?:url[L,QSA]#HandlingtailwithnoparametersRewriteCond%{REQUEST_FILENAME}!-fRewriteCond%{REQUEST_FI

php - Zend_Form_Element_Captcha 异常问题...?

在我的Zend应用程序中,我遇到了Captcha元素的异常问题。当我尝试查看我在本地计算机上使用此Captcha元素的表单时,它工作正常,但是当我将它上传到我的Debian服务器时,它无法正常工作...!!!区别如下:正如您在本地主机上看到的,验证码内的文本显示给用户,而在服务器[Debian]上,文本丢失了!!!!!!我使用以下代码在我的Zend表单上创建了验证码元素:$elements=array();$captchaElement=newZend_Form_Element_Captcha('captcha',array('label'=>"IhrgenerierterTextco

php - HTML/Apache/PHP 的 <Form> 标签中的 <Input> 标签数量是否有限制?

好吧,这很奇怪。我使用带有mysql后端的php创建了一个简单的地址簿。于是我加了138行地址,就没问题了。顺便说一句,我在输入文本中显示我的地址,以便任何用户都可以随时编辑它。因此,当我按下提交按钮时,它会对所有138行条目执行httppost并更新它们。一切都很好....然而,有一天,当我尝试更新第139行输入时,它丢弃了最后一个输入并给出错误!它给出了一个php运行时错误:“注意:未定义索引:第24行C:\wamp\www\Dawah\go.php中的lastN”。顺便说一句,LastN变量是使用$_post['lastN']获得的。好像单个表单可以发的html输入标签数量有限制

php - Htaccess : How to get Variable form URL?

我有一个关于htaccess的问题。我正在尝试执行以下操作:blabla.com/lala和blabla.com/lululala和lulu是我的变量(在两个站点上显示不同的内容,但它是同一个文件(example.php)。所以我在htaccess中所做的是:RewriteRule^([^&]+)$example.php?type=$1但是当回应GET[type]时,我只得到文件名(“example.php”)。但我希望它显示“lala”或“lulu”。当我这样做时它会起作用:RewriteRule^blablabla/([^&]+)$example.php?type=$1但我只是不需

php - 我们可以为一个 zend\form 设置多个水化器吗?

为什么?因为,我想用它们为一个表单附加多个模型/实体。我怎么看?在我看来,我必须在一个模型/实体中获取所有数据,然后填充多个表(使用Mapper或Gateway),但逻辑上一个模型用于一个表。我建议的解决方案是什么?所以要在多个表中添加一个表单数据,我必须使用两个模型。但在ZF2中,一个表单可以使用$form->setHydrator拥有一个Hydrator。我想知道什么?此问题的任何其他可能性。谢谢。 最佳答案 您是否考虑过使用formCollections?基本上,您将为每个实体创建一个字段集,具有自己的字段和水化器。然后创建一